Why AI matters at this scale

Technogen, Inc., a 201-500 employee IT services firm founded in 2003 and based in Chantilly, Virginia, operates at the critical intersection of government contracting and enterprise digital transformation. This mid-market size band is a sweet spot for AI adoption—large enough to have structured data and repeatable processes, yet agile enough to pivot faster than bureaucratic mega-consultancies. The firm's primary challenge is scaling expertise: winning and delivering complex federal contracts requires deep technical talent that is scarce and expensive. AI offers a force-multiplier effect, automating the knowledge work that bogs down highly-paid engineers and proposal teams, directly impacting the bottom line through improved win rates and utilization.

Concrete AI opportunities with ROI

1. Automated Proposal Factory Government RFPs are notoriously complex and document-heavy. A Generative AI system fine-tuned on Technogen's past winning proposals, technical white papers, and compliance matrices can auto-generate 70% of a first draft. This cuts the proposal development cycle from weeks to days, allowing the firm to bid on more contracts with the same overhead. The ROI is measured in increased bid volume and a 5-10% higher win rate, translating directly to millions in new revenue.

2. Intelligent Resource Orchestration Matching cleared personnel with specific technical skills to project needs is a constant, manual struggle. An AI model trained on consultant profiles, project requirements, and historical performance data can predict optimal team compositions and forecast bench availability. This reduces the costly "bench gap" between contracts by 15-20%, significantly improving margins in a business where people are the primary asset.

3. Legacy Code Modernization Accelerator Many federal systems run on outdated codebases. Using Large Language Models to analyze, document, and refactor legacy languages (like COBOL or Java 7) into modern cloud-native patterns creates a new, high-margin service line. This AI-accelerated approach can reduce migration timelines by 40%, offering a compelling value proposition to government clients and generating a first-mover advantage.

Deployment risks specific to this size band

For a firm of 200-500 employees, the biggest risk is not technological but organizational. A failed AI pilot can erode trust and waste scarce investment. The key risk is data security; as a government contractor, any AI tool handling Controlled Unclassified Information (CUI) must operate within strict compliance boundaries like FedRAMP. A data leak from a public LLM would be catastrophic. The mitigation is to deploy self-hosted, open-source models within the firm's existing secure cloud enclave. The second risk is talent cannibalization; if senior engineers see AI as a threat to their billable hours, they will resist. The solution is a transparent change management strategy that positions AI as a co-pilot that eliminates the least enjoyable parts of their job—like writing documentation—while elevating their role to strategic advisor.

How can a mid-sized IT services firm like Technogen start with AI?
Begin with internal productivity use cases like RFP automation and knowledge management. These offer quick wins with low client data risk, building internal expertise before client-facing rollouts.
What are the main AI risks for government contractors?
Data sovereignty, CUI/FCI handling compliance, and model bias are paramount. Any AI solution must be deployable in a GovCloud or on-premise air-gapped environment to meet strict federal regulations.
Will AI replace our consultants?
No, AI will augment them. It automates repetitive tasks like documentation and boilerplate coding, freeing consultants for higher-value architecture, security, and client strategy work that requires human judgment.
How do we ensure our AI solutions are secure for federal clients?
Prioritize self-hosted, open-source LLMs within your existing authority-to-operate boundaries. Implement robust guardrails for PII/source code leakage and maintain a human-in-the-loop for all critical outputs.
What ROI can we expect from AI in professional services?
Typical ROI comes from 30-50% reduction in proposal and documentation time, 15-20% better resource utilization, and faster project delivery. The key is measuring reduced overhead and improved win rates.
How do we manage change resistance when introducing AI tools?
Involve senior engineers in tool selection, frame AI as a co-pilot to eliminate drudgery, and invest in prompt engineering and AI literacy training. Celebrate early wins publicly to build momentum.
What AI skills should we hire for or develop internally?
Focus on prompt engineering, LLM orchestration frameworks like LangChain, and MLOps for model fine-tuning. Domain expertise in government IT combined with these AI skills is a rare, high-value combination.
